Output 31f5de811504ed1f11419d5fb1775023e00750ea9f6120ec637bd54ea27c7bda:29

value
188700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5dcbe53d9bb2c2ab2ecc800936ff93937580bf5 OP_EQUAL
address
3KjDUrnzS1ei31UefFymWVr1fynNrZfZnV
transaction
31f5de811504ed1f11419d5fb1775023e00750ea9f6120ec637bd54ea27c7bda